EN | AR

324 Full Stack Developer jobs in Saudi Arabia

Full Stack Developer

Riyadh, Riyadh Master Works

Posted 9 days ago

Job Viewed

Tap Again To Close

Job Description

Overview

Master Works is seeking a highly experienced Full Stack Developer to join our team. In this role, you will take the lead in designing and implementing modern web applications that support business-critical systems and user-facing platforms. You will collaborate with product managers, designers, and other development teams to ensure seamless integration, high performance, and scalable solutions that drive business objectives.

Key Responsibilities
  • Lead the design and architecture of full-stack applications, ensuring scalability, maintainability, and performance optimization.
  • Develop comprehensive frontend and backend components using ReactJS, NodeJS, and TypeScript.
  • Collaborate with stakeholders to define requirements and translate business needs into technical specifications.
  • Implement coding standards, testing strategies, and best practices across the stack.
  • Optimize application performance, troubleshoot issues, and conduct code reviews.
  • Provide guidance and mentorship to junior developers.
  • Stay updated with the latest web development technologies and trends.
  • Document architectures, data flows, APIs, and processes for future reference and compliance.
Requirements
  • Bachelor's or master's degree in Computer Science, Software Engineering, or a related field.
  • Proven experience (3+ years) as a Full Stack Developer or in a similar role.
  • Extensive knowledge of ReactJS (hooks, state management, Redux) and NodeJS.
  • Strong proficiency in TypeScript (frontend & backend).
  • Experience building and consuming RESTful APIs and working with relational and non-relational databases (e.g., PostgreSQL, MongoDB).
  • Familiarity with frontend build tools, version control (Git), and CI/CD pipelines.
  • Hands-on experience with unit/integration testing (Jest, Mocha, Cypress).
  • Strong understanding of web application architecture, performance optimization, and responsive design.
  • Excellent problem-solving skills and ability to work under tight deadlines.
  • Strong communication skills and ability to present complex technical concepts to non-technical stakeholders.
  • Knowledge of cloud platforms (AWS, Azure, GCP), GraphQL, Docker/Kubernetes is a plus.
Seniority level
  • Mid-Senior level
Employment type
  • Full-time
Job function
  • Other
Industries
  • IT Services and IT Consulting

Riyadh, Riyadh, Saudi Arabia — 16 hours ago

We’re unlocking community knowledge in a new way. Experts add insights directly into each article, started with the help of AI.

#J-18808-Ljbffr
This advertiser has chosen not to accept applicants from your region.

MERN Stack Developer

Riyadh, Riyadh Vasundhara Game Studio

Posted 10 days ago

Job Viewed

Tap Again To Close

Job Description

Your next big opportunity is just a click away. Requirement for the MERN Stack Developer Responsibilities:
  • Design and build applications systems based on wireframes and product requirements documents
  • Work on back-end & front-end development of core scripts using NodeJS/ MongoDB/React.js/Angular/Express /Redux.
  • Unit test code for robustness, including edge cases, usability and general reliability
  • Write reusable, easy to maintain, versioned code using DRY principles
  • Integrate existing tools and business systems (in-house tools)
  • Good exposure in creating dynamic web pages
  • Familiarity with Server-Oriented Architecture and RESTful Web Services
  • Mentor junior team members on system architecture, coding styles and inculcate an attitude of continuous improvement in the team members
Skills Required:
  • Knowledge of data structures and algorithms
  • Hungry for more responsibility and knowledge
  • Passion for building robust systems that are engineered to handle failure scenarios, an undying love and attitude for maintaining coding standards
  • Strong advocate for producing quality software who makes sure issues are raised and resolved
  • Familiarity with RESTful APIs to connect front-end to back end services
  • Experience in cloud message APIs and push notifications (firebase preferably)
  • Experience with at least one of the cloud platforms like AWS, GCP, Azure, Digital Ocean etc.
  • Experience with GraphQL ecosystem a plus
#J-18808-Ljbffr
This advertiser has chosen not to accept applicants from your region.

Full Stack Developer

Riyadh, Riyadh Master Works

Posted 15 days ago

Job Viewed

Tap Again To Close

Job Description

Master works is seeking a highly experienced Full Stack Developer to join our team.

In this role, you will take the lead in designing and implementing modern web applications that support business-critical systems and user-facing platforms. You will collaborate with product managers, designers, and other development teams to ensure seamless integration, high performance, and scalable solutions that drive businessobjectives.

Key Responsibilities:
  • Lead the design and architecture of full-stack applications, ensuring scalability, maintainability, and performance optimization.
  • Develop comprehensive frontend and backend components using ReactJS, NodeJS, and TypeScript .
  • Collaborate with stakeholders to define requirements and translate business needs into technical specifications.
  • Implement coding standards, testing strategies, and best practices across the stack.
  • Optimize application performance, troubleshoot issues, and conduct code reviews.
  • Provide guidance and mentorship to junior developers.
  • Stay updated with the latest web development technologies and trends.
  • Document architectures, data flows, APIs, and processes for future reference and compliance
  • Bachelor’s or master’s degree in Computer Science, Software Engineering, or a related field.
  • Proven experience (3+ years) as a Full Stack Developer or in a similar role.
  • Extensive knowledge of ReactJS (hooks, state management, Redux) and NodeJS .
  • Strong proficiency in TypeScript (frontend & backend).
  • Experience building and consuming RESTful APIs and working with relational and non-relational databases (e.g., PostgreSQL, MongoDB).
  • Familiarity with frontend build tools, version control (Git), and CI/CD pipelines.
  • Hands-on experience with unit/integration testing (Jest, Mocha, Cypress).
  • Strong understanding of web application architecture, performance optimization, and responsive design .
  • Excellent problem-solving skills and ability to work under tight deadlines.
  • Strong communication skills and ability to present complex technical concepts to non-technical stakeholders.
  • Knowledge of cloud platforms (AWS, Azure, GCP), GraphQL, Docker/Kubernetes is a plus.

#J-18808-Ljbffr
This advertiser has chosen not to accept applicants from your region.

Full Stack Developer

Riyadh, Riyadh Royal Cyber KSA

Posted 17 days ago

Job Viewed

Tap Again To Close

Job Description

Overview

Lead Full Stack Developer -React / Backend Developer/ Frontend Developer

Location: Saudi Arabia- Riyadh

Experience: 5+ years in Full Stack Development with React experience

Job Type: Full-time

Responsibilities
  • Frontend Development: Develop sophisticated UIs using React.js, leveraging hooks, context API.
  • Backend Development: Build robust APIs using Node.js, Express.js; work with databases like MongoDB, PostgreSQL.
  • Full Stack Integration: Seamlessly integrate frontend (React) with backend APIs.
  • UI/UX Implementation: Collaborate with designers for responsive, pixel-perfect UIs.
  • Performance Optimization: Ensure app performance, scalability, responsiveness.
  • Testing & Quality: Write unit/integration tests (Jest, Mocha); ensure code quality.
  • Version Control: Use Git for code management; collaborate via GitHub/GitLab.
  • CI/CD Involvement: Participate in deployment pipelines (Jenkins, Docker beneficial).
  • Security Practices: Implement security best practices for web apps.
  • Collaboration & Communication: Work closely with Product, Design, QA teams.
  • Code Reviews: Conduct reviews for code quality, best practices.
  • Technical Problem-Solving: Debug complex frontend/backend issues.
  • Documentation: Maintain technical documentation for solutions.
  • Stay Updated: Keep abreast of latest React, Node.js developments.
  • Mentorship: Guide junior developers as needed.
Skills & Qualifications
  • React.js Expertise: 3+ years strong experience with React, hooks.
  • Backend Proficiency: Skilled in Node.js, Express.js for APIs.
  • Database Experience: MongoDB, PostgreSQL; SQL/NoSQL knowledge.
  • JavaScript/TypeScript: Strong JS/TS skills for frontend/backend.
  • State Management: Experience with Redux, MobX for React.
  • RESTful APIs: Skilled building/consuming REST APIs.
  • Responsive Design: Expertise in CSS3, responsive web techniques.
  • Testing Skills: Familiarity with Jest, React Testing Library.
  • Git & Collaboration: Proficient with Git workflows.
  • Problem-Solving: Strong analytical, debugging skills.
  • Communication: Excellent English communication skills.
  • Education: Bachelor’s/Master’s in Computer Science or related.
  • Experience: 5+ years full stack development with React focus.
  • Adaptability: Adaptable to evolving tech/project needs.
  • Attention to Detail: Focus on UI/UX quality, code best practices.

#J-18808-Ljbffr
This advertiser has chosen not to accept applicants from your region.

Full Stack Developer

Riyadh, Riyadh Virginiasourcing

Posted 18 days ago

Job Viewed

Tap Again To Close

Job Description

We are a trusted recruitment partner for organizations across the Middle East. Established in 2016, we specialize in delivering unparalleled talent solutions by leveraging our strategic market presence and understanding of evolving industry dynamics.

About the Role

Our customer is seeking a Full Stack Developer to contribute to success in the Technical domain.

Requirements
  • Bachelor’s degree in a relevant field
  • 3–7 years of relevant experience
  • Strong communication and collaboration skills
  • Proficiency with industry-standard tools/software
  • Ability to manage multiple tasks and deadlines
  • Knowledge of compliance and governance standards
  • Experience in the related industry
  • Strong problem-solving and analytical skills
  • Ability to work in cross-functional teams
  • Fluency in English; Arabic is a plus
  • Proven track record of delivering results
  • Adaptability to fast-paced environments

#J-18808-Ljbffr
This advertiser has chosen not to accept applicants from your region.

Full-Stack Developer

Riyadh, Riyadh Amyal

Posted 18 days ago

Job Viewed

Tap Again To Close

Job Description

Overview

Amyal is an E-service platform for online ticket & Hotel Booking, under the umbrella of Al-Jazea Group of companies. We are looking for Full stack developers.

Number of Vacancies: 4

If you have the required skills, please share your resume now.

Subject: Full stack Developer

Job Specification

Skills:

  • Good understanding of server-side CSS preprocessors, such as LESS and SASS
  • User authentication and authorization between multiple systems, servers, and environments
  • Integration of multiple data sources and databases into one system
  • Management of hosting environment, including database administration and scaling an application to support load changes
  • Data migration, transformation, and scripting
  • Setup and administration of backups
  • Understanding differences between multiple delivery platforms such as mobile vs desktop, and optimizing output to match the specific platform
  • Creating database schemas that represent and support business processes
  • Implementing automated testing platforms and unit tests
  • Proficient knowledge of a back-end programming language PHP Laravel
  • Proficient understanding of code versioning tools, such as Git
  • Proficient understanding of OWASP security principles
  • Understanding of “session management” in a distributed server environment

#J-18808-Ljbffr
This advertiser has chosen not to accept applicants from your region.

Full Stack Developer

Riyadh, Riyadh Master Works

Posted today

Job Viewed

Tap Again To Close

Job Description

Master works is seeking a highly experienced Full Stack Developer to join our team.

In this role, you will take the lead in designing and implementing modern web applications that support business-critical systems and user-facing platforms. You will collaborate with product managers, designers, and other development teams to ensure seamless integration, high performance, and scalable solutions that drive businessobjectives.

Key Responsibilities:
  • Lead the design and architecture of full-stack applications, ensuring scalability, maintainability, and performance optimization.
  • Develop comprehensive frontend and backend components using ReactJS, NodeJS, and TypeScript .
  • Collaborate with stakeholders to define requirements and translate business needs into technical specifications.
  • Implement coding standards, testing strategies, and best practices across the stack.
  • Optimize application performance, troubleshoot issues, and conduct code reviews.
  • Provide guidance and mentorship to junior developers.
  • Stay updated with the latest web development technologies and trends.
  • Document architectures, data flows, APIs, and processes for future reference and compliance
  • Bachelor’s or master’s degree in Computer Science, Software Engineering, or a related field.
  • Proven experience (3+ years) as a Full Stack Developer or in a similar role.
  • Extensive knowledge of ReactJS (hooks, state management, Redux) and NodeJS .
  • Strong proficiency in TypeScript (frontend & backend).
  • Experience building and consuming RESTful APIs and working with relational and non-relational databases (e.g., PostgreSQL, MongoDB).
  • Familiarity with frontend build tools, version control (Git), and CI/CD pipelines.
  • Hands-on experience with unit/integration testing (Jest, Mocha, Cypress).
  • Strong understanding of web application architecture, performance optimization, and responsive design .
  • Excellent problem-solving skills and ability to work under tight deadlines.
  • Strong communication skills and ability to present complex technical concepts to non-technical stakeholders.
  • Knowledge of cloud platforms (AWS, Azure, GCP), GraphQL, Docker/Kubernetes is a plus.
#J-18808-Ljbffr

This advertiser has chosen not to accept applicants from your region.
Be The First To Know

About the latest Full stack developer Jobs in Saudi Arabia !

MERN Stack Developer

Riyadh, Riyadh Vasundhara Game Studio

Posted today

Job Viewed

Tap Again To Close

Job Description

Your next big opportunity is just a click away. Requirement for the MERN Stack Developer Responsibilities:
  • Design and build applications systems based on wireframes and product requirements documents
  • Work on back-end & front-end development of core scripts using NodeJS/ MongoDB/React.js/Angular/Express /Redux.
  • Unit test code for robustness, including edge cases, usability and general reliability
  • Write reusable, easy to maintain, versioned code using DRY principles
  • Integrate existing tools and business systems (in-house tools)
  • Good exposure in creating dynamic web pages
  • Familiarity with Server-Oriented Architecture and RESTful Web Services
  • Mentor junior team members on system architecture, coding styles and inculcate an attitude of continuous improvement in the team members
Skills Required:
  • Knowledge of data structures and algorithms
  • Hungry for more responsibility and knowledge
  • Passion for building robust systems that are engineered to handle failure scenarios, an undying love and attitude for maintaining coding standards
  • Strong advocate for producing quality software who makes sure issues are raised and resolved
  • Familiarity with RESTful APIs to connect front-end to back end services
  • Experience in cloud message APIs and push notifications (firebase preferably)
  • Experience with at least one of the cloud platforms like AWS, GCP, Azure, Digital Ocean etc.
  • Experience with GraphQL ecosystem a plus
#J-18808-Ljbffr
This advertiser has chosen not to accept applicants from your region.

Full Stack Developer

Riyadh, Riyadh Virginiasourcing

Posted today

Job Viewed

Tap Again To Close

Job Description

We are a trusted recruitment partner for organizations across the Middle East. Established in 2016, we specialize in delivering unparalleled talent solutions by leveraging our strategic market presence and understanding of evolving industry dynamics.

About the Role

Our customer is seeking a Full Stack Developer to contribute to success in the Technical domain.

Requirements
  • Bachelor’s degree in a relevant field
  • 3–7 years of relevant experience
  • Strong communication and collaboration skills
  • Proficiency with industry-standard tools/software
  • Ability to manage multiple tasks and deadlines
  • Knowledge of compliance and governance standards
  • Experience in the related industry
  • Strong problem-solving and analytical skills
  • Ability to work in cross-functional teams
  • Fluency in English; Arabic is a plus
  • Proven track record of delivering results
  • Adaptability to fast-paced environments
#J-18808-Ljbffr

This advertiser has chosen not to accept applicants from your region.
 

Nearby Locations

Other Jobs Near Me

Industry

  1. request_quote Accounting
  2. work Administrative
  3. eco Agriculture Forestry
  4. smart_toy AI & Emerging Technologies
  5. school Apprenticeships & Trainee
  6. apartment Architecture
  7. palette Arts & Entertainment
  8. directions_car Automotive
  9. flight_takeoff Aviation
  10. account_balance Banking & Finance
  11. local_florist Beauty & Wellness
  12. restaurant Catering
  13. volunteer_activism Charity & Voluntary
  14. science Chemical Engineering
  15. child_friendly Childcare
  16. foundation Civil Engineering
  17. clean_hands Cleaning & Sanitation
  18. diversity_3 Community & Social Care
  19. construction Construction
  20. brush Creative & Digital
  21. currency_bitcoin Crypto & Blockchain
  22. support_agent Customer Service & Helpdesk
  23. medical_services Dental
  24. medical_services Driving & Transport
  25. medical_services E Commerce & Social Media
  26. school Education & Teaching
  27. electrical_services Electrical Engineering
  28. bolt Energy
  29. local_mall Fmcg
  30. gavel Government & Non Profit
  31. emoji_events Graduate
  32. health_and_safety Healthcare
  33. beach_access Hospitality & Tourism
  34. groups Human Resources
  35. precision_manufacturing Industrial Engineering
  36. security Information Security
  37. handyman Installation & Maintenance
  38. policy Insurance
  39. code IT & Software
  40. gavel Legal
  41. sports_soccer Leisure & Sports
  42. inventory_2 Logistics & Warehousing
  43. supervisor_account Management
  44. supervisor_account Management Consultancy
  45. supervisor_account Manufacturing & Production
  46. campaign Marketing
  47. build Mechanical Engineering
  48. perm_media Media & PR
  49. local_hospital Medical
  50. local_hospital Military & Public Safety
  51. local_hospital Mining
  52. medical_services Nursing
  53. local_gas_station Oil & Gas
  54. biotech Pharmaceutical
  55. checklist_rtl Project Management
  56. shopping_bag Purchasing
  57. home_work Real Estate
  58. person_search Recruitment Consultancy
  59. store Retail
  60. point_of_sale Sales
  61. science Scientific Research & Development
  62. wifi Telecoms
  63. psychology Therapy
  64. pets Veterinary
View All Full Stack Developer Jobs